JPMB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2021 in Review
18 of the 5,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in JPMorgan USD Emerging Markets Sovereign Bond ETF (JPMB) for Q3 2021, worth a combined $55M — down 20% from $68.9M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 2 funds opened new JPMB posit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 8 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Jane Street, adding an estimated $728K.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$14.5M.
